Registered with ACRA on July 5, 2010, ASKI Global Ltd. is a non-stock, non-profit global development organization whose mother organization is a 24 year old non-government organization, Alalay sa Kaunlaran, Inc. We recognize the presence of many Filipino Contract workers in Singapore and thus, aim to help this target group, acquire an entrepreneurial mindset that would lead them to productive, happy and wealthy family life.
Adhering to this advocacy, ASKI Global Ltd. intends to directly help both the OFW and their families set up, operate and grow enterprises in the Philippines whereby ASKI Philippines coach and mentor OFW Families on business management while our global office in Singapore do the same for our “kababayans” here. Value formation trainings will likewise be conducted here simultaneously with the Philippines.
We will regionalize our OFW project in other countries where there are big overseas Filipino workers’ communities and will serve other foreign workers in Singapore like the Indonesians and Sri Lankans. ASKI Global intends to direct the productive use of remittances and address employment problems in many developing countries, through SME development.
Moreover, ASKI Global Ltd. aims to assist other NGOs , GOs and private companies in Asia design community projects that reflects a “do well-do good”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) image.
ASKI Philippines
ASKI, the mother organization, was officially registered with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) on March 23, 1987 as a non-stock, non-profit organization committed to the promotion and development of micro and small-to-medium enterprises and the delivery of social services. It formally launched operations on July 1, 1987. From its starting fund of Php 460,000, ASKI’s investment has grown to a total portfolio of Php 76M in 2004. From a small playing field in Cabanatuan City, ASKI has branched out into other provinces in Central Luzon and adjacent Regions I and II. From a handful of savings and loan services, ASKI’s lines have diversified into a capital build-up and other cooperating arrangements.
ASKI attributes its success to a values-oriented philosophy on entrepreneurial lending, believing that no Return on Equity can be realized without an informed, responsible and conscientious clientele.For ASKI’s loan portfolio in complemented by support services like values training, social preparation, community organizing, institution building and financial management. ASKI today goes on, inspired by the confidence that the strength of any country lies in a strong middle class that can only come about by putting into the hands of the micro entrepreneur what he needs to become a macro.
